Hey! I'm here with rob digiovanni.

He's the senior marine biologist here

At the riverhead foundation for marine research and preservation.

Oh, wow! So, rob, is that a baby sea turtle?

Yes. It's a baby green sea turtle.

It's one we rescued from orient point.

Whoa! Wait, wait. You re--you rescued that little turtle?

What did you rescue it from?

Was it, like, stuck on a tall building

And you had to fly up and rescue it?

No. We don't put on a cape,

But in this case here it was on the beach.

So a family was walking along the beach,

And they found nutmeg washed up,

And nutmeg was cold-stunned,

Which is like hypothermia or freezing.

She was too cold, so you guys warmed her up.

Yes. We brought her back to our facility here,

And what we did is warmed her back up.

Oh. So you rescued her.

You're making her better so she's ok,

And then they're gonna let nutmeg go back in the wild

And grow up just like a real wild sea turtle.
